About Toyo Tires Financial Statements

Toyo Tires stakeholders use historical fundamental indicators, such as Toyo Tires' Net Income From Continuing Ops, to determine how well the company is positioned to perform in the future. Although Toyo Tires investors may analyze each financial statement separately, they are all interrelated. For example, changes in Toyo Tires' assets and liabilities are reflected in the revenues and expenses on Toyo Tires' income statement, which ultimately affect the company's gains or losses.
